Malaysia Producer Prices Fall 2.7%

Malaysia’s producer prices continued to decline at the end of the year, figures from the Department of Statistics showed on Wednesday. Producer prices dropped 2.7 percent year-on-year in December, faster than the 1.8 percent decrease in November. Prices have been falling since March. BoJ Mintes On Tap For Wednesday

The Bank of Japan will on Wednesday release the minutes from its Dec. 17-18 monetary policy meeting, highlighting a light day for Asia-Pacific economic activity. Resilience amid tariff hikes – BNY

BNY Head of Markets Macro Strategy Bob Savage discusses the impact of recent U.S. tariff increases on South Korean imports, which have risen to 25%. Despite initial weakness in the Korean Won (KRW), domestic sentiment and foreign equity inflows have helped stabilize South Korean assets.
